The Importance of Poly Flat Belts in Modern Industry


In the ever-evolving landscape of modern manufacturing and industrial processes, poly flat belts have emerged as essential components that contribute significantly to efficiency and productivity. These belts are made from high-quality polymers and are characterized by their flexibility, durability, and resistance to wear, making them ideal for a variety of applications.


Poly flat belts are commonly used in conveyor systems, where they facilitate the smooth and reliable movement of goods and materials. Their design allows for a wide range of loading capacities, and they can be tailored to meet specific operational needs. This adaptability makes them suitable for industries such as food processing, packaging, and automotive, where precise handling and speed are crucial.


One of the standout features of poly flat belts is their resistance to environmental factors. They can withstand various temperatures, moisture levels, and chemical exposures, ensuring longevity and reducing the frequency of replacements. This durability translates to lower maintenance costs for companies, which is a significant advantage in a competitive marketplace.

Moreover, poly flat belts are engineered for minimal friction and noise, enhancing operational efficiency and creating a more pleasant working environment. Their smooth operation minimizes wear on machinery and reduces energy consumption. As industries strive to adopt more sustainable practices, the energy efficiency of poly flat belts aligns with green initiatives, making them a preferred choice for environmentally conscious manufacturers.


Another critical aspect is the ease of installation and adjustment. Poly flat belts come in various sizes and can be customized to fit specific machinery configurations. This flexibility allows for quick replacements and adjustments, minimizing downtime—a crucial factor in maintaining productivity levels in fast-paced industrial settings.


In terms of innovation, advancements in material science continue to improve the performance of poly flat belts. Enhanced properties, such as increased tensile strength and improved bonding with pulleys, are making these belts even more reliable. With constant research and development, the future of poly flat belts looks promising, indicating a trend towards even more efficient industrial operations.


In conclusion, poly flat belts are invaluable assets in modern industry, combining durability, adaptability, and efficiency. As businesses look to streamline their operations and reduce costs while maintaining high standards of productivity, the adoption of poly flat belts will undoubtedly play a pivotal role in shaping the future of manufacturing and logistics.
